55361fa4f6 Release RSocket setup payload when it is not handled
This commit counterbalances the retain in the MessagingRSocket
handleConnectionSetupPayload method with a conditional release on SETUP
frame type in handleNoMatch, preventing Netty buffer leaks.

6be0432e3d Use ConnectionLostException after heartbeat failures
ConnectionLostException was applies only after the WebSocket library
notified us of a session close. However, read inactivity and heartbeat
send failures are also cases of the connection being lost rather than
closed intentionally.

This commit also ensures resetConnection is called after a heartbeat
write failure, consistent with other places where a transport error
is handled that implies the connection is lost.

8815788004 Allow an existing TaskExecutor to be configured in ChannelRegistration
This commit introduces a new method to configure an existing
TaskExecutor in ChannelRegistration. Contrary to
TaskExecutorRegistration, a ThreadPoolTaskExecutor is not necessary,
and it can't be further configured. This includes the thread name
prefix.

01f717375b Introduce ObjectUtils#nullSafeHash(Object... element)
This commit deprecates the various nullSafeHashCode methods taking array
types as they are superseded by Arrays.hashCode now. This means that
the now only remaining nullSafeHashCode method does not trigger a
warning only if the target type is not an array. At the same time, there
are multiple use of this method on several elements, handling the
accumulation of hash codes.

For that reason, this commit also introduces a nullSafeHash that takes
an array of elements. The only difference between Objects.hash is that
this method handles arrays.

The codebase has been reviewed to use any of those two methods when it
is possible.

5bc80fc094 Disable SpEL selector support in WebSocket messaging by default
This commit disables support for evaluating SpEL expressions from
untrusted sources by default. Specifically, this applies to the
SpEL-based 'selector' header support in WebSocket messaging, which
includes the DefaultSubscriptionRegistry and the classes used to
configure the 'selector' header name (SimpleBrokerMessageHandler and
SimpleBrokerRegistration).

The selector header support remains in place but will have to be
explicitly enabled beginning with Spring Framework 6.1.

For example, a custom implementation of WebSocketMessageBrokerConfigurer
can override the configureMessageBroker() method and configure the
selector header name as follows.

  registry.enableSimpleBroker().setSelectorHeaderName("selector");
